1. Metal Stalls
Metal is a common material used in the construction of bathroom stalls. Typically made from stainless steel or powder-coated steel, these partitions are known for their strength and resistance to damage. The metal panels are usually constructed with a honeycomb core, which provides stability and prevents them from denting easily.
2. Plastic Stalls
Plastic bathroom stalls are another popular option, especially in areas where moisture and humidity are prevalent. Made from high-density polyethylene (HDPE), these partitions offer excellent resistance to water, making them suitable for environments such as swimming pools or coastal regions. Plastic stalls are also highly resistant to graffiti, scratches, and corrosion.
3. Solid Phenolic Stalls
Solid phenolic stalls are a durable and cost-effective choice for commercial restrooms. These partitions are composed of multiple layers of resin-impregnated kraft paper that are fused together under high heat and pressure. The result is a dense and sturdy material that is resistant to moisture, impact, and vandalism.
4. Fiberglass Reinforced Plastic (FRP) Stalls
Fiberglass reinforced plastic (FRP) bathroom stalls are constructed using a composite material composed of glass fibers embedded in a polymer matrix. FRP stalls are lightweight yet durable, making them suitable for a variety of restroom environments. They are resistant to moisture, impact, and scratches, making them a popular choice for high-traffic areas.
5. Powder-Coated Steel Stalls
Powder-coated steel bathroom stalls combine the strength of steel with a durable powder coating finish. The steel panels are treated with an electrostatically sprayed powder coating that is cured under heat, resulting in a smooth and resistant surface. This coating helps protect the stalls from scratches, wear, and corrosion, ensuring their longevity.
6. Laminate Stalls
Laminate bathroom stalls are made by bonding layers of decorative paper with resin under high pressure. The resulting material is known for its versatility, as it can mimic various textures and patterns, including wood grains or solid colors. Laminate stalls are relatively easy to clean and maintain, making them a practical choice for many restroom facilities.
7. Stainless Steel Stalls
Stainless steel bathroom stalls offer both durability and a sleek appearance. These stalls are constructed using sheets of stainless steel that are resistant to corrosion, stains, and bacterial growth. Stainless steel stalls are often chosen for their aesthetic appeal and ability to withstand harsh cleaning agents, making them ideal for healthcare facilities and high-end restrooms.
8. Compact Laminate Stalls
Compact laminate bathroom stalls are made from multiple layers of kraft paper infused with phenolic resin and compressed under high pressure. This manufacturing process creates a dense, robust material that is resistant to moisture, impact, and graffiti. Compact laminate stalls are commonly used in areas where durability and resistance to vandalism are essential.

Materials Used in Bathroom Stalls
1. Phenolic: Phenolic is a popular material used in bathroom stall construction. It is made by layering multiple sheets of resin-impregnated kraft paper and compressing them under high heat. The resulting solid panel is highly resistant to water, humidity, impact, and graffiti. Phenolic bathroom stalls are known for their durability and low maintenance requirements.
2. Stainless Steel: Stainless steel is another common option for bathroom stalls. It is known for its sleek appearance, durability, and resistance to corrosion. Stainless steel stalls are often used in high-end or heavily frequented restrooms due to their long-lasting nature.
3. Plastic Laminate: Plastic laminate is a cost-effective choice for bathroom stalls. It consists of layers of resin-impregnated paper that are bonded together under high pressure. While not as durable as phenolic or stainless steel, plastic laminate stalls offer a wide range of colors and patterns to choose from.
4. Powder-Coated Steel: Powder-coated steel stalls are made by applying a dry powder coating to steel panels and curing them under heat. This process creates a tough, smooth, and colorful finish that is resistant to scratches and corrosion. However, powder-coated steel stalls may be more prone to chipping and require regular maintenance.

2. Common Materials Used
There are several common materials used in the construction of bathroom stalls:
a) Powder-Coated Steel
Powder-coated steel is a popular choice for bathroom stall partitions. It is known for its strength and durability, making it suitable for high-traffic areas. The steel is treated with a powder coating that provides a protective layer, making it resistant to scratches, moisture, and corrosion. Additionally, powder-coated steel stalls are available in various colors and finishes, allowing for customization to match the restroom's aesthetics.
b) Plastic Laminate
Plastic laminate is another commonly used material for bathroom stalls. It consists of multiple layers of resin-impregnated kraft paper, which are pressed together under high heat and pressure. This manufacturing process creates a solid and sturdy panel that is resistant to water, stains, and impact. Plastic laminate stalls come in a wide range of colors and patterns, providing design flexibility for restroom aesthetics.
c) Solid Phenolic Core
Solid phenolic core bathroom stalls are constructed using multiple layers of resin-impregnated cellulose fibers. These layers are compressed under high heat and pressure to form a dense and robust panel. Solid phenolic core stalls are highly resistant to water, impact, and vandalism. They are also antimicrobial, making them a hygienic option for public restrooms.
d) Stainless Steel
Stainless steel stalls offer exceptional durability and resistance to corrosion. They are often chosen for their sleek and modern appearance. Stainless steel bathroom stalls are highly resistant to moisture, stains, and damage, making them suitable for high-moisture environments such as swimming pools or gymnasiums.
